About Autism Explorers
Autism Explorers is an autism specific community group that supports and nurtures new and existing skills and interests. This group will provide children with opportunities to be part of a community group and work on their fine motor, gross motor, emotional regulation and social skills. Bucket time, story time and other group activities will be offered. There will be plenty of opportunities where parents can be supported by our volunteers and other parents or carers that attend.
